Warcraft at 25 - Memories & Stories

Last week, I had the opportunity to head out to Irvine, California to participate in a media event to outline some of the first details about the Warcraft celebration. I had the privilege to speak with Principal Software Engineer Bob Fitch and Senior Vice President Chris Sigaty. While both have lofty titles today, each was crucial to the development of the RTS series. Bob came to Blizzard in 1992 and Chris in 1996. With each having such a long history with Warcraft, the stories they told of the early days are absolutely the coolest gems of company lore.


WoW Classic Interview: Release Date & Preserving a Legend

On a partly cloudy day in Irvine, California last week, I had the chance to learn a lot more about World of Warcraft Classic, the game that is on many of our community members’ lips these days. Classic hearkens back to an earlier time in MMOs, a time in the genre’s earliest days where the play was the tool to building communities and relationships with others around the world. With the release of WoW Classic this summer, Blizzard is looking to bring back, not only memories of the way the game played in its infancy, but also to bring back the sense of community.
